Experts have said the heatwave, which lasted from about June 20-28, was the worst recorded in Europe

It comes as Public Health France announced an increase of 29.1% in the number of deaths in France from 22 to 28 June compared to the week prior.

The increase in deaths is concentrated almost entirely among people aged 45 and over
